Body

  1. Walnuts – Power-packed with omega-3 fatty acids, walnuts have been proven to support brain health and improve cognitive function. These little gems also contain antioxidants and vitamin E, which help to combat oxidative stress in the brain. A handful of walnuts can provide a satisfying crunch and a valuable brain boost during your study sessions.

  2. Dark Chocolate – Yes, you read it right! Dark chocolate, particularly those with higher cocoa content, offers numerous health benefits. Rich in flavonoids and antioxidants, it enhances blood flow to the brain, promoting improved focus and concentration. Enjoy a small piece of dark chocolate as an indulgent treat while reaping its cognitive benefits.

  3. Blueberries – These tiny blue wonders are packed with antioxidants, reducing inflammation and oxidative stress in the brain. Studies have shown that the consumption of blueberries can enhance memory, attention, and overall cognitive function. Blend them into a smoothie, sprinkle them on yogurt, or snack on them by the handful for a delicious and brain-boosting treat.

  4. Greek Yogurt – With its high protein content, Greek yogurt provides a sustainable source of energy while keeping you feeling full and satisfied. It also contains probiotics, which contribute to a healthy gut. Research suggests that a healthy gut microbiome positively influences brain health and cognition. Enjoy Greek yogurt on its own or add some fruits and nuts for an extra nutritional punch.

  5. Avocado Toast – Avocados are packed with healthy monounsaturated fats, which support the brain’s structure and function. They are also a great source of vitamins C, E, and B, promoting mental clarity and overall cognitive health. Spread some mashed avocado on whole-grain bread for a delicious and nutrient-dense snack that will keep you fueled throughout the day.

FAQ Section

  1. Are these snacks suitable for everyone?
    These snacks are generally suitable for most people. However, it’s important to consider any allergies or dietary restrictions you may have. Consult with a healthcare professional if you have specific concerns.

  2. Can I replace walnuts with other nuts?
    While walnuts offer unique benefits, other nuts such as almonds, cashews, or pecans can also be healthy alternatives. However, remember that each nut variety provides its specific nutritional profile.

  3. What dark chocolate percentage should I look for?
    It’s best to choose dark chocolate with a cocoa content of 70% or higher. This ensures a higher concentration of flavonoids and antioxidants.

  4. Can I use frozen blueberries instead of fresh ones?
    Absolutely! Frozen blueberries retain most of their nutritional value and can be just as beneficial as fresh ones. They are also a convenient option when fresh blueberries are out of season.

  5. Is it necessary to use Greek yogurt specifically?
    Greek yogurt is recommended due to its higher protein content and thicker consistency. However, if you prefer other types of yogurt, opt for unsweetened varieties to avoid extra added sugars.
